大型数据库开发与设计
餐饮管理系统设计与开发
——前台设计与开发
学号:
姓名:
班级:
日期:
目录
一、需求分析 1
(一)、编写目的 1
1
1
1
1
2
5
二、概念设计 7
(一)、系统整体逻辑架构 7
7
: 7
7
8
(二)、各功能模块功能设计 8
8
2. 后台管理 9
3. 财务管理 10
11
11
(三)、各功能模块架构设计 12
12
15
17
(四)、系统E-R图以及所对应数据表的分析 18
(五)、E-R图详细设计 21
三、逻辑结构设计 21
(一)、E-R图向关系模型的转换 21
四、物理设计 22
(一)界面以及权限的设计 22
22
23
(二)开台及点菜等设置 24
24
24
25
26
(三)员工注册设置 26
五、总结 27
餐饮管理系统
一、需求分析
(一)、编写目的
随着服务业的不断发展以及人们生活节奏的加快,许多餐饮机构都需要通过信息化管理来达到提高工作效率、降低运营成本和吸引更多客户的目的。而本软件的编写就是为了实现对餐饮机构的信息化管理,同时利用本需求分析让使用户和软件开发者双方对该软件的初始规定有一个共同理解的目的。主要为项目管理人员和开发人员提供参考。
传统的餐饮管理现在已经很难应对当今社会对餐饮业的管理要求,它与现在的基于计算机技术发展起来的餐饮信息管理系统对比,有以下几大不同:
便捷性方面:传统的人工对餐饮信息进行管理,如:顾客信息管理,菜单信息管理和订餐信息的管理,都是很繁琐的过程,其中的任何一步过程都要浪费大量的时间,而随着计算机技术的发展,这些原本繁琐的问题都会变得轻而易举。
安全性方面:传统的纸质记录方式查询起来很麻烦,而且保密性很差,并且容易磨损丢失,对于会员余额的管理是非常不利的。但如果采用的是电子文档的方式进行数据的保存,这一切都变得非常简便,你可以方便的对数据信息进行备份查询,并且数据的安全性可以得到最大程度的保证。
准确性方面:传统的人工记账容易出错,如果采用这种方式来处理现在的含有打折信息的消费结算会使得工作量很大,如果计算出错将严重影响自己的声誉。而如果使用软件系统,这些问题都将不会出现,计算机的错误率几乎为零。
鉴于以上传统的人工管理方式的种种缺陷,我设计了方便中小级别餐饮企业使用的应用程序,通过它,管理者可以基本解决以上所遇到的种种问题,并且更加科学的对老客户进行打折,而且添加了主顾权限的不同设计使得它更加方便雇主对雇员的管理与监督。
本系统是一套功能强大而又简便实用的餐饮娱乐管理软件,包括前台定义、营业设置、营业分析、财务查询、库存管理、辅助管理、系统管理和帮助信息等八大功能模块,实现了餐饮娱乐企业日常运行的全面自动管理,是餐饮娱乐企业进行电脑信息化管理的理想选择。
本系统可广泛适用于各种规模、各种类型的餐饮娱乐企业,如餐厅、酒楼、歌舞厅、夜总会、桑拿、酒吧、咖啡厅、快餐店和综合娱乐场所等。
(1)、钟军等,《数据库高级实例导航》,科学出版社;
(2)、王珊,萨师瑄等,《数据库概论》,高等教育出版社;
该系统主要针对各大酒店餐饮部的具体业务流程开发设计,系统提供较好的功能扩充接口。开发该软件是为了满足公司对餐饮信息管理的方便,以现代化的创新思维模式去工作。
(1)、开发意图
提高酒店或者饭店餐饮部的管理效率,适应信息化需求。
(2)、应用目标
通过本系统软件,能帮助工作人员利用计算机,快速方便地对餐饮信息交流进行管理、输入、输出、查找的所需工作,是杂乱的业务数据能够具体化、直观化和合理化。
(3)、用户特点
本系统用于各大餐饮部的管理工作人员,要求其具有一般的计算机操作基础。对餐饮工作流程比较清楚。
(4)、假定和约束
a、本项目的开发经费不超过50000元
b、项目管理1人,开发人员3人,软件测试人员2人
c、本项目开发期限为3个月
(1)、对功能的规定主要功能包括:
登录信息IPO表:
餐饮管理IPO表:
查询系统信息IPO表:
营业设置系统IPO表:
财务查询(由总室监控)IPO表:
需求功能框图:
(2)、对性能的规定
a、精度
具有较高的安全性,系统对不同的用户提供不同的
餐饮系统 来自淘豆网m.daumloan.com转载请标明出处.